import { EditorBase } from '../editor-base/editor-base'; /** * 文件上传编辑器 * * @export * @class UploadEditor * @extends {EditorBase} */ export default class UploadEditor extends EditorBase { /** * 是否忽略表单项值变化 * * @type {boolean} * @memberof AppDefaultEditor */ ignorefieldvaluechange?: any; /** * 是否开启行内预览 * * @type {boolean} * @memberof AppDefaultEditor */ rowPreview?: any; /** * 高拍仪图片 * * @private * @type {Array} */ protected imgFiles: Array; /** * 编辑器初始化 * * @memberof UploadEditor */ initEditor(): Promise; /** * 绘制上传类组件 * * @memberof UploadEditor */ renderUploadEditor(): import("vue").VNode; /** * 绘制上传类组件 * * @memberof UploadEditor */ renderUploadBase64(): import("vue").VNode; /** * 绘制磁盘上传组件 * * @memberof UploadEditor */ renderDiskUpload(): import("vue").VNode; /** * 绘制高拍仪组件 * * @memberof UploadEditor */ renderCameraUpload(): import("vue").VNode; /** * 绘制内容 * * @returns {*} * @memberof UploadEditor */ render(): any; } //# sourceMappingURL=upload-editor.d.ts.map